Bikelawyer gets UK’s largest ever CRPS settlement for client – £1.9 million full liability valuation

A motorcyclist injured in 2008 has settled her Complex Regional Pain Syndrome (CRPS) case for £1.9 million on a full liability basis, the UK’s highest ever compensation awarded in such a case.

Miss X, who wishes to remain anonymous, was represented by Andrew Campbell of Bikelawyer Motorcycle Accident Solicitors. Her initially modest injuries led to the onset of CRPS. The condition rendered the Claimant wheelchair reliant since 2009. The majority of the settlement will be spent on future care, accommodation and loss of earnings.

After a reduction for agreed contributory negligence the net award was over £1.4 million.
Commenting on the case, her solicitor, Andrew Campbell, said “This was a heavily contested and difficult case but I am delighted with the outcome which will enable my client to have a future free of financial concern.”
